Cold winds suddenly rose in the inky darkness of the night, making the decay on the dilapidated residence door more noticeably appalling as it rattled in the wind.

A few elder maids passed through the courtyard hurriedly. A servant with a wider figure than the rest, who wore a green robe with her sleeves rolled up halfway, headed towards the innermost room with a food basket in hand.

A strange odour permeated throughout the residence. A slightly younger maid, trailed behind her and whispered, "The smell is really unpleasant. I don't know why Master arranged for that thing to be there. It is quite scary." When she got to this point, she could not resist crying out in shock and edged herself closer to whisper into the head elder maid's ear to continue, "It couldn't be for-"

"Wang [1], speak less." The green-clad elder maid was slightly annoyed. "If anyone around us overhears, you won't be spared."

[1] Wang(王贵家) - When you're a servant, you're referred to as belonging to someone's family or clan since you're considered their property. Hence, this is more of Wang's family maid, or Wang's family servant.

Wang silenced herself hastily.

Arriving at the entrance, a young, round-faced maid emerged from within and accepted the food basket, before entering the house again. After a moment, she carried an empty food basket out. The green-clad elder maid took it and spoke to the round-faced maid, "Master ordered us to bring the person into the room."

"Is this for-" The round faced maid was alarmed.

"We do not need to know." Sighing, the green-clad elder maid summoned Wang. "Come here and bring the person over there."

A lamp lit the house, brightening the hall slightly. Wang pinched her nose, only noticing the thing that sat in the wooden basin after several moments had passed. Seeing it for the first time, she almost threw up. Over the course of the past few days, even if she had delivered food daily with the green-clad elder maid, she had never seen the person inside clearly.

The thing in the wooden basin could no longer be referred to as "human". All four of her limbs had been severed, her rod-like body propped up, as it swayed in the wooden basin. Her hair was bunched together, with small bits of debris scattered throughout. It vaguely looked female.

The green-clad elder maid stared, sympathy flashing through her eyes. Although she did not have an inkling of this lady's identity, this lady had already been crippled to this extent, which really made her pity the lady. Furthermore since Master had suddenly ordered them to bring her out today, things did not bode well for her.
